    Great job! I made something similar using an old stainless steel laundry tub on its side that I put in front of our wood burner. It has a pizza oven thermometer inserted in the plug hole. Works a treat but I found that as it’s so open, I had to put a piece of tinfoil across the top edge to make the opening a bit smaller and trap the heat a bit longer. So far, I’ve only done a slow cooked casserole but I was very happy with the result. 😊

    • @thebossoftheswamp
      @thebossoftheswamp  Рік тому

      I've done similar and will make a video in the future. This is open on the side because it needs to reflect the heat from the flames.
